Motorola razr (2022) is slightly better than Moto X Pure Edition (2015), having a global score of 81.1 against 74.1. The Motorola razr (2022) design is noticeably newer and noticeably thinner than Moto X Pure Edition (2015)'s, but it is also heavier. Motorola razr (2022) has a greater hardware performance than Moto X Pure Edition (2015), because it has a larger number of cores and a greater amount of RAM memory.
The Moto X Pure Edition (2015) counts with a little sharper screen than Motorola razr (2022), because although it has a little smaller screen, it also counts with a better 1440 x 2560 resolution and a higher amount of pixels per screen inch. The Motorola razr (2022) takes slightly better pictures and videos than Motorola Moto X Pure Edition (2015), and although they both have the same 30 fps video frame rates and the same (4K) video resolution, the Motorola razr (2022) also has a larger camera aperture to capture better images in poorly lited situations and a lot better 50 mega pixels resolution back-facing camera.
The Motorola razr (2022) counts with a slightly better storage to store more games and applications than Motorola Moto X Pure Edition (2015), because although it has no external SD slot, it also counts with more internal storage capacity. The Motorola razr (2022) counts with a little longer battery duration than Moto X Pure Edition (2015), because it has a 17% bigger battery size.
